Can Östradiol help with Fruchtbarkeit?

Estradiol (E2) is the primary estrogen and plays a key role in female fertility by regulating the menstrual cycle, thickening the endometrium, and supporting ovulation. Adequate estradiol levels are necessary for conception, but supplementing estradiol does not automatically improve fertility. In reproductive medicine, estradiol is used therapeutically—for example, in IVF protocols to prepare the uterine lining or in cases of estrogen deficiency. However, taking estradiol without a medical indication can disrupt natural hormone balance, impair endometrial receptivity, and increase thromboembolic risk. Evidence for estradiol's benefit in fertility is strong in specific clinical scenarios (e.g., thin endometrium, controlled ovarian stimulation), but weak for general fertility enhancement. A 2023 meta-analysis confirmed that estradiol supplementation in ART improves endometrial thickness but not live birth rates in all women. Therefore, while estradiol is essential for fertility, its use as a 'help' is limited to targeted medical contexts. Always consult a specialist before using hormonal supplements.
